At ClickUp data is the key driver behind the decisions we make every day. Our teams rely on accurate and up to date data to measure their success and to build a better product. An ideal candidate would have strong SQL skills, experience conducting experiments and advising PMs on experimentation best practices, and the ability to answer challenging business/product questions through the use of a data warehouse and raw data sources.

The Role:

  • Partner with product managers and executives to help drive product decisions by extracting meaningful insights from large sets of data.
  • Spearhead ClickUp's experimentation efforts in Product. Design and run A/B tests, develop best practices on experimentation, and forge processes that enable the team to run fast, meaningful experiments, extracting valuable insights from results.
  • Turn loosely defined problems into practical analyses.
  • Acquire a deep understanding of our users and contextual data nuances, interpreting and conveying findings to key stakeholders.
  • Develop a strong business sense and understanding of business performance drivers.
  • Utilize proactive and autonomous initiative to understand the needs of the org and drive forward the right project while also supporting others that can benefit from your expertise.
  • Data Stack: Snowflake, SQL, DBT, Eppo, Segment, Amplitude, Tableau, Hex, AWS.

Qualifications:

  • 4+ experience as a Product Analyst or Product Data Scientist with 2+ years experience in SaaS.
  • A strong understanding of software business principles and SaaS metrics.
  • Proven expertise in conducting and interpreting A/B tests.
  • Proficiency with BI tools (Tableau, Looker, QuickSight) and event tracking platforms (Segment, Heap, etc...).
  • Advanced skills in SQL transformations and relational databases.
  • Self-motivated, operationally-focused, and a problem-solver.
  • Excellent interpersonal, written, and oral communication skills.

Desirable:

  • Extensive knowledge of Amplitude and event instrumentation.
  • Knowledge of product led growth initiatives and monetization/engagement drivers.
  • Experience building statistical models using Python or R.
